The Essential Characteristics of a Wise Person: Exploring the 7 Pillars of Wisdom

What sets apart a wise person from the rest? Is it their intelligence or their life experiences? While both contribute to wisdom, there are certain essential characteristics that form the foundation of a wise person’s persona. In this article, we will explore the 7 pillars of wisdom that are crucial to develop and strengthen to become a truly wise person.

Pillar 1: Humility

Humility is the cornerstone of wisdom. Without it, one cannot learn from others or improve oneself. A wise person is humble enough to acknowledge their own limitations and open to new perspectives. They don’t impose their beliefs on others but instead listen to different viewpoints and strive to understand them.

Pillar 2: Curiosity

A curious mind is a hallmark of a wise person. They are always eager to learn and explore new areas of knowledge. They question everything, not for the sake of being argumentative, but to gain deeper insights and understanding.

Pillar 3: Empathy

Empathy is the ability to put oneself in another’s shoes and understand their feelings and perspectives. A wise person is empathetic and compassionate towards others, which allows them to build stronger relationships and effectively communicate with people.

Pillar 4: Resilience

Life is full of ups and downs. A wise person understands this and strives to develop resilience in the face of adversity. They do not give up in the face of challenges but instead use setbacks as opportunities to grow.

Pillar 5: Prudence

Prudence is the ability to make sound and responsible decisions. A wise person exercises prudence by considering all available information and weighing the pros and cons before making a decision.

Pillar 6: Integrity

Integrity is the foundation of trustworthiness. A wise person upholds their values and principles, even in difficult situations. They are honest and transparent in their dealings with others, which earns them respect and admiration.

Pillar 7: Gratitude

Gratitude is the attitude of being grateful and thankful for what one has. A wise person understands the importance of expressing gratitude and appreciates the many blessings in their life. They are not materialistic and find joy in the simple things in life.

In conclusion, wisdom is not something that can be attained overnight. It is a lifelong journey that requires the cultivation of these seven essential pillars. A wise person is humble, curious, empathetic, resilient, prudent, of good integrity, and expresses gratitude. By striving to develop these traits, we can all become wiser and more fulfilled individuals.
